Diana Pundole Takes on Yas Marina in Middle East Debut

Diana Pundole delivered an impressive performance at the iconic Yas Marina Circuit in Abu Dhabi, competing in her first ever Passione Ferrari Club Challenge Middle East. Taking on one of the region’s most renowned Formula 1 venues, Diana showcased composure, speed and determination throughout the weekend, finishing 4th overall.

The event marked an important milestone in Diana’s racing journey as her debut appearance in the Middle East series. Reflecting on the experience, Diana described the weekend as a blend of excitement, learning and pure adrenaline. With each session, she continued to refine her pace and build confidence on the demanding Yas Marina layout, ultimately delivering a personal best lap of 1:57.424.

Stretching over 5.2 km, Yas Marina Circuit is known for its technical and varied layout, combining long high-speed straights with tight hairpins and heavy braking zones. The circuit demands precise braking, strong rhythm and confidence through its flowing sections, particularly after the long back straight and into the technical final sector.

“Every session was a mix of fun, learning, focus and pure adrenaline,” Diana shared after the race weekend. “Finishing fourth overall in my first outing at this level feels like a huge milestone and gives me even more motivation for what’s ahead.”

With a strong debut result and valuable track experience gained, Diana leaves Abu Dhabi with momentum and growing confidence as she continues her journey in the Passione Ferrari Club Challenge. As she put it herself, this is only the beginning.
